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Pobranie pliku PHP bez jego wykonywania
Forum PHP.pl > Inne > Hydepark
neoTz^
Witam ponownie smile.gif
Mam do was pytanie czy istnieje możliwość pobrania całego pliku PHP z serwera np.: przez jakiś program lub przeglądarkę bez wykonania tego pliku przez serwer ?
Chodzi o to żeby pobrać cały plik PHP a nie kod wynikowy.
Chce po eksperymentować i sprawdzić czy jest możliwość zabezpieczenia skryptu przed jego pobraniem.
mike
Nie ma. No chyba że serwer CI na to pozwoli i wyśle sam.
Jeśli serwer jest ustawiony na interpretowanie pliku .php to nie ma takiej możliwości.
athabus
oczywiście, że jest - np. przez ftp :-)

Ale zakładając, że serwer jest poprawnie skonfigurowany i nie masz danych do takiego konta jest to niemożliwe*

*niemożliwe, ale wiadomo że każde zabezpieczenia można obejść, także np. po włamaniu na serwer jest to możliwe

//edit mike był szybszy
neoTz^
A czy jest możliwe żeby z zewnątrz podczas pobierania pliku powstrzymać ten proces wykonania go który normalnie powinien nastąpić (wg konfiguracji) i pobrać ten plik w całości jak każdy inny ?

Przeglądarka podczas łączenia się z serwerem wymiana z nim wiele danych a tam gdzie jest wymiana danych teoretycznie istnieje możliwość przejęcia (chociażby częściowej) kontroli nad drugim urządzeniem (W tym wypadku serwerem).
athabus
Nie nie ma. Do przeglądarki jest wysyłany TYLKO rezultat - najczęściej plik html lub inny tekst. PHP jest wykonywane po stronie serwera.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.